Global Bond Yields Rise on Middle East Conflict and Inflation Concerns

Global government bond yields rose sharply amid escalating Middle East tensions involving the U.S., Israel, and Iran, which triggered a surge in oil and gas prices. Investors fear higher energy costs will accelerate inflation, potentially delaying or reducing central banks' interest-rate cuts. This dynamic affected U.S. Treasuries, Japanese government bonds, and European debt, with market participants anticipating earlier or sustained rate hikes to counter inflation pressures amid ongoing geopolitical uncertainty.
